What is the definition of a small size coffee order in terms of cream or sugar?

The definition of a small size coffee order pertaining to cream, sugar, or flavor pumps is two of each. This standard ensures that when a customer orders a small coffee with cream or sugar, they receive a balanced flavor that is consistent with Dunkin's service expectations. The guideline of two units allows customers to taste the coffee while still providing some level of creaminess or sweetness without overwhelming the beverage.

This approach aligns with the operational procedures at Dunkin, ensuring customer satisfaction by delivering a drink that meets the established flavor profile for small orders. Understanding this standard helps staff prepare orders accurately and efficiently, enhancing the overall customer experience.
